If I may break out my old-man syndrome, the idea of splitting the lists
has come up multiple times over the years trilug has been in existence.
After careful consideration, we shot it down when I was chair because of
the effect it had on other groups - effectively splintering the groups,
the discussions, and the effectiveness of the group.

In the end, we did try it for a while, and in the mailing lists created
for the subcommittees/interests withered and died in favor of the main
list.

For TriLUG, one list and good etiquette   seems to work. And I agree
that if it ain't broke, don't fix it!
